Rai pays back money he borrowed from Wallace’s mom

Thumbnail

Aaron Rai took home his first European Tour title Sunday when he held onto a six-shot overnight lead to win the Hong Kong Open by one in a downpour.

But he took home our hearts when fellow Englishman Matt Wallace shared this tweet Friday:

“AED” is the currency of the United Arab Emirates, where Wallace finished second at the DP World Tour Championship last week and where Rai was 48th.

The amount borrowed, 200 dirham, converts to £42.46, or €48, or $54.45.

For his victory in Hong Kong, Rai walked away with €292,343, which comes out to £258,610.39, or $331,589.99, or 1,217,996.56د.إ.
